In the year 1849, fourteen-year-old Susanna Fairchild finds herself navigating the tumultuous landscape of her family's hopes and dreams amidst the California Gold Rush. Following the death of her father, life takes an abrupt turn, thrusting her family into uncertainty. Susanna’s diary serves as both a refuge and a poignant chronicle of her daily struggles as they embark on a perilous journey westward, driven by ambition and the promise of fortune.
As they traverse through rugged terrains, Susanna encounters a myriad of emotions, from despair to determination. The challenges faced on the road—loss, loneliness, and the weight of responsibility—shape her character and resolve. Alongside her mother and siblings, she learns the art of survival, as the harsh realities of gold-seeking life clash with her youthful dreams.
Her reflections reveal not only the stark trials of the era but also the tender moments that bind her family closer. The diary captures the spirit of resilience, offering insights into the hopes that blossom in the face of adversity. Susanna emerges as a testament to the strength of the human spirit, showcasing how even in the toughest times, hope can take root.
Through vivid storytelling, readers are transported to a time rife with challenge and possibility, where a young girl's heart remains steadfast in the search for a better future. Susanna Fairchild's journey becomes emblematic of an era, echoing the lessons of perseverance and hope that resonate across generations.
